ABSTRACT:
A hybrid system working machine, during a normal working time, operated by a normal operation mode that the output of a power generator and the accumulated power of a capacitor are used while the engine is operated over a high-efficiency range at a low output. Switching of a selector switch to a high-speed running mode position and running operation enable long-distance and high-speed running of an increase in engine output by a high-output operation mode.
